I exchanged a few e-mails with Fritz Peterson recently, wishing him birthday nachas. He said he was excited that the Matt Damon-Ben Affleck project about the family-switching he did with Yankee teammate Mike Kekich was being made into a feature film. But evidently not everyone is enthralled with that possibility.

I can understand Kekich’s point of view, but why would MLB and the Yankees need to be involved? They couldn’t actually put the kibosh on the movie, could they? On the other hand, I guess someone has to gicve permission to use the team names, uniforms, logos, etc. **Sigh**
